Heavy Levity on the factic life.
As a being there you are subject to a time, subject to a place and you were not free to choose the time or the place (time and place is the umwelt – the world around). This lack of freedom is something Heidegger called facticity – the inescapable accidents of your existence, like being born in 1970, in Ohio... and also you are not merely in the world, you are thrown into the world – another great german word: geworfenheit. However, working through Sein und Zeit, one learns that after being thrown into the world, you freely choose your future, you freely choose your time and place but always in the light of historical constraints. You can be authentic while recognizing your facticity.
